区块链应用交易的完整流程及操作指南

1. 简介

随着区块链技术的发展,区块链应用交易变得越来越普遍。区块链应用交易是一种基于分布式账本、去中心化和透明性的交易方式,可以用于数字资产的买卖、转移、交换等操作。本文将详细介绍区块链应用交易的完整流程,并探讨其在安全性方面的优势。

2. 区块链应用交易流程

区块链应用交易的流程主要包括以下几个步骤:

2.1 创建钱包

在进行区块链应用交易前,用户需要创建一个钱包。钱包是用户存储和管理数字资产的地方,类似于传统金融系统中的银行账户。创建钱包时,用户会生成一个私钥和对应的公钥,私钥用于验证交易的合法性和加密数字资产,公钥用于接收数字资产。

2.2 查找交易对象

在进行交易之前,用户需要找到自己想要交易的对象。这可以通过在线交易平台、社群、论坛等方式实现。交易对象可能是其他用户或者数字资产的出售方。

2.3 发起交易请求

一旦找到了交易对象,用户可以发起交易请求。交易请求包括交易的具体内容,如交易的数字资产类型、数量、价格等。用户可以使用自己的私钥对交易请求进行数字签名,以证明这个交易是合法的。

2.4 确认交易

交易请求发送之后,交易对象会接收到这个请求并进行确认。交易对象可以查看交易请求的详细信息,并决定是否接受或拒绝这个交易。一旦交易对象接受了交易请求,交易就会进入下一步。

2.5 完成交易

一旦交易被确认,交易就会被写入区块链的区块中,并广播给整个网络。其他节点会验证这个交易的合法性,并将其添加到自己的区块链副本中。同时,数字资产的所有权和转移信息也会被更新。

3. 区块链应用交易的安全性

区块链应用交易具有以下安全性优势:

3.1 去中心化

区块链应用交易是去中心化的,没有中间人参与交易过程,降低了交易的风险。每个参与者都可以验证和记录交易,确保交易的安全性和透明性。

3.2 加密技术

区块链应用交易使用加密技术对交易数据进行保护。私钥和公钥的使用、数字签名等手段可以防止交易数据被篡改和伪造,提高了交易的安全性。

3.3 不可篡改性

一旦交易被写入区块链,就不可篡改。区块链使用哈希算法和共识机制来确保交易的不可逆性和可追溯性,防止交易被篡改或删除。

4. 相关问题

以下是关于区块链应用交易的一些常见

4.1 区块链应用交易是否安全?

区块链应用交易基于密码学和去中心化的特点,具有较高的安全性。但用户在交易过程中仍需注意防范风险,如保管好私钥、选择可信的交易对象等。

4.2 区块链应用交易可以转移哪些类型的资产?

区块链应用交易可以转移各种形式的数字资产,包括加密货币、数字证券、电子票据等。

4.3 区块链应用交易的费用如何计算?

区块链应用交易的费用主要包括矿工费用和网络使用费用。矿工费用由矿工决定,用户可以根据交易的重要性和紧急程度进行适当的设置。

4.4 区块链应用交易的速度如何?

区块链应用交易的速度取决于交易的确认时间和区块链网络的拥堵程度。一般情况下,交易确认时间较短,但在网络拥堵时可能会有一定延迟。

4.5 区块链应用交易如何保护用户隐私?

区块链应用交易通过公钥加密和匿名交易等方式保护用户隐私。用户在交易中只需使用公钥进行身份验证,不需要暴露个人身份信息。

总结:区块链应用交易是一种基于区块链技术的数字资产交易方式,具有去中心化、安全性和不可篡改等特点。用户在进行区块链应用交易时需要了解其完整流程和安全性优势,并注意防范风险。常见问题中包括交易安全性、资产类型、费用计算、交易速度和用户隐私等问题。